Graeco-Roman Marriage Papyri
Graeco-Roman Marriage Papyri Of the Ancient Greek, Roman and Jewish world, by David Instone Brewer of Tyndale House, Cambridge, U.K.: first class, extensive new web site on which "every published Greek, Roman and Jewish marriage contract and divorce deed is collected . . . from the 4th Century BCE to the 4th Century CE. Each text is presented in its original language, with references to English translations, other online texts, and online images of the papyrus.
 

Conflict and Community in the Corinthian Church
Edited by J. Shannon Clarkson: excellent and extensive materials from The Women's Division of the General Board of Global Ministries, The United Methodist Church. This well designed web-site is both scholarly and devotional. Current features include Corinth at the Time of Paul's Arrival, Maps Related to the Life of Paul and an Annotated Bibliography and more features are to be added throughout 2000 and 2001. A Basic Vocabulary of Biblical Studies For Beginning Students
By Fred L. Horton, Jr., Kenneth G. Hoglund, and Mary F. Foskett of Wake Forest University: excellent index of all the technical terms that beginning students will need. If you have ever wondered what an "apophthegm", a "pericope", the "septuagint" or "koine" meant but never dared ask, this page is for you. Rudolf Bultmann, Jesus and the Word
Full reproduction of the English translation of Bultmann's classic book of 1926, prepared for Religion On-Line by Ted & Winnie Brock. This is one of the latest additions to the Historical Jesus page.
